【问题标题】:Android GPS Tracker is not disabledAndroid GPS 追踪器未禁用
【发布时间】:2011-09-13 19:14:41
【问题描述】:

我在 android 中遇到 GPS 的问题。

在我的代码中,我只是根据当前位置在地图上显示一个标记,并且它工作正常。

当我调用此代码时 GPS 跟踪器引擎符号出现在屏幕顶部。 在 onPause() 方法中,我调用了 myLocManager.removeUpdates(this) ,但即使我不在那个活动中 *GPS 追踪器没有被禁用.. 这让我很头疼,因为即使应用程序处于睡眠模式,它也会消耗更多的电池。

我正在使用 MyItemizedOverlay 在位置更新时绘制标记。

谁能帮我解决这个问题..?

提前致谢。

【问题讨论】:

    标签: android gps tracker


    【解决方案1】:

    您是否使用MyLocationOverlay 来显示您的当前位置?

    MyLocationOverlay 自行处理位置更新,即它使用 GPS。致电.disableMyLocation() 停止位置更新。

    【讨论】:

    • 感谢您的回复。不,我正在使用 MyItemizedOverlay。在这种情况下如何禁用我的位置。
    猜你喜欢
    • 2023-03-26
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多